According to FutureWise analysis, the DNA Repair Drugs Market in 2025 is US$8.75 billion, and is expected to reach US$24.20 billion by 2033 at a CAGR of 13.56%.
The DNA Repair Drugs Market is experiencing an exciting surge, driven by two key forces: the rising incidence of cancer and the growing adoption of targeted therapies that precisely tackle the intricate mechanisms behind DNA damage. North America is leading the charge in this dynamic landscape, commanding about 42% of the global market share. This impressive figure reflects the region's cutting-edge healthcare infrastructure, its robust research initiatives, and a pressing demand for groundbreaking cancer treatments. Industry leaders are diving deep into research and development, with a particular focus on developing innovative po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ase (PARP) inhibitors. These drugs are designed to target specific genetic weaknesses in cancer cells, offering new hope for patients. In addition to PARP inhibitors, there’s a wave of new therapeutics in the pipeline aimed at enhancing the DNA damage response, ultimately boosting treatment efficacy and improving patient outcomes. As our understanding of genetic mutations deepens, the shift toward personalized medicine is gaining momentum. Healthcare providers are increasingly committed to customizing treatments based on individual genetic profiles, which not only maximizes therapeutic effectiveness but also minimizes the likelihood of side effects.
